onegentleguy:


On the part in bold, broadly yes.

But there's also plan B.

A few banks may decide to go the route of a bonus issue, which is another means of issuing share capital and increasing their paid-up/paid-in capital, instead of a rights issue.
The way to guage the probability that a bank could do a plan B would be to look at the anatomy of her SCS and juxtapose it with her SPA.

There's also a possibility that some banks might decide on both a plan A and B (,ref: rights issue and bonus issue)

debeey87:
If you have a stock portfolio of over 50m,

Will you sell to generate fixed income of at least 10m given current rates of over 20%. If not how will you balance your portfolio to also take advantage of bothe the ngx and fixed income rates. Total annual dividend from same portfolio is less than 4m

This is not a bad idea at all.

I would split it 20% 80%. 20% in FI and CP investments. And 80% in equities. Giving that I'm still "young", I'd take as many calculated risk as possible at this age as I can still stomach risks considering my risk appetite. Just imagine buying DS/NS at current prices and then it's relisted at say N100. That's almost 100% ROI. You can even consider other fundamentally sound stocks for Capital appreciation and good dividend payouts... E go make sense. That's my 2kobo sha
